Output 23f81ecc69a25a5b352bccf8621d560fa856d46e03e811620d5dd369bd713cdf:7

value
10363124
script pubkey
OP_0 OP_PUSHBYTES_20 80fa9d1d08dd1064b0dd5fdd8fa09a685e6fbd85
address
bc1qsraf68ggm5gxfvxatlwclgy6dp0xl0v9qw4fsm
transaction
23f81ecc69a25a5b352bccf8621d560fa856d46e03e811620d5dd369bd713cdf
confirmations
180239
spent
true